EB-5 Immigrant Investor

Permanent residence through a qualifying investment that creates jobs in the United States.

General overview

EB-5 allows qualifying investors, and their spouse and unmarried children under 21, to seek permanent residence by investing in a new commercial enterprise that creates the required number of full-time positions for U.S. workers. Investments may be made directly or through a designated regional centre, and the invested capital must be lawfully sourced and placed at risk.

Main application stages

  1. 1Project and structure review with authorized U.S. counsel
  2. 2Source-of-funds documentation and investment
  3. 3Investor petition filed with USCIS by counsel
  4. 4Consular processing or adjustment of status
  5. 5Later petition to remove conditions on residence

General eligibility considerations

  • Investment amount thresholds published by USCIS, which change over time
  • A new commercial enterprise and the required job creation
  • Detailed lawful source-of-funds evidence
  • Conditional residence followed by a removal-of-conditions stage

Common documentation categories

  • Comprehensive source and path-of-funds records
  • Project offering, business plan and job-creation analysis
  • Tax returns and financial statements
  • Identity and civil documents

Important limitations

  • Capital must be genuinely at risk; investment loss is possible

  • Residence is conditional at first and is not guaranteed

What is the minimum investment?

Thresholds are set by law and published by USCIS, and they change. Confirm the current figure on the official page and with U.S. counsel.
